如何在“全栈测试笔记”中记录测试人员项目经验?

在信息技术高速发展的今天,全栈测试已成为软件开发过程中不可或缺的一环。作为测试人员,记录项目经验对于个人成长和团队协作都具有重要意义。本文将围绕“如何在‘全栈测试笔记’中记录测试人员项目经验”这一主题,从以下几个方面展开论述。

一、明确记录目的

在开始记录之前,首先要明确记录的目的。以下是几个常见的记录目的:

  • 个人成长:通过记录项目经验,总结经验教训,不断提升自己的测试技能。
  • 团队协作:将项目经验分享给团队成员,促进团队整体水平的提升。
  • 知识积累:为后续项目提供参考,避免重复犯错。

二、构建笔记框架

为了使笔记更加清晰、有条理,建议构建以下笔记框架:

  1. 项目背景:包括项目名称、所属行业、开发周期、团队规模等信息。
  2. 测试目标:明确本次测试的目标,如功能测试、性能测试、安全测试等。
  3. 测试策略:阐述测试方法、测试工具、测试用例设计等。
  4. 测试过程:记录测试执行过程中的关键步骤、遇到的问题及解决方案。
  5. 测试结果:总结测试过程中发现的问题,包括问题类型、严重程度、修复情况等。
  6. 经验教训:总结本次测试过程中的经验教训,为后续项目提供借鉴。

三、记录内容要点

以下是一些在记录过程中需要注意的要点:

  • 清晰简洁:使用简洁明了的语言描述,避免冗长和重复。
  • 重点突出:重点记录测试过程中的关键信息,如测试用例、测试数据、测试结果等。
  • 图文并茂:使用图表、截图等方式展示测试过程和结果,提高可读性。
  • 案例分析:结合实际案例,分析测试过程中遇到的问题及解决方案,使内容更具说服力。

四、案例分析

以下是一个简单的案例分析:

项目背景:某电商平台移动端App,开发周期3个月,团队规模10人。

测试目标:功能测试、性能测试、安全测试。

测试策略:采用黑盒测试方法,使用Appium进行自动化测试,结合手动测试进行验证。

测试过程

  1. 功能测试:针对App的各个功能模块进行测试,确保功能正常运行。
  2. 性能测试:测试App在不同网络环境下的性能表现,如加载速度、响应速度等。
  3. 安全测试:测试App的安全性,如数据加密、权限控制等。

测试结果

  • 功能测试:发现20个缺陷,已全部修复。
  • 性能测试:在3G网络环境下,App的平均加载速度为2秒,响应速度为1秒。
  • 安全测试:未发现安全漏洞。

经验教训

  1. 在功能测试阶段,要注重测试用例的覆盖率和质量,确保功能正常运行。
  2. 在性能测试阶段,要关注网络环境对性能的影响,针对不同网络环境进行测试。
  3. 在安全测试阶段,要重视数据安全和用户隐私保护。

五、总结

在“全栈测试笔记”中记录测试人员项目经验,有助于个人成长、团队协作和知识积累。通过明确记录目的、构建笔记框架、记录内容要点和案例分析,可以更好地记录和总结项目经验,为后续项目提供借鉴。

猜你喜欢:全栈链路追踪